Specialty Community Information: Lying on the beautiful Gulf Coast
of southern Mississippi, Biloxi lies directly on the Mississippi
Sound and is a principal city of the Gulfport-Biloxi Metropolitan
area, which has a combined population of 421,916. With its French
Colonial roots, Biloxi is one of the oldest communities in the
country, having first been settled in 1699, yet continues its
charm, culture, cuisine and welcoming southern attractiveness to
both visitors and residents alike, and remains a favored vacation
destination due to its proximity to coastal beaches and breezes,
mild winters and warm summer days. Today, the city is a cultural
melting pot, with a year ’round schedule of celebrations, set
against a backdrop of sugar-white sand beaches, great deep-sea or
freshwater fishing, an array of championship golf courses, museums
and historic sites, tantalizing seafood restaurants, and the
excitement of 24-hour, non-stop casino resorts. Benefits and
